Job Summary & Responsibilities
This position is responsible for partnering closely with accountholders calling our contact center to provide valuable support , education, and direction on products like Flexible Spending Accounts (FSA), Heathcare Savings Accounts (HSA), COBRA, and others .
The H&B Support Specialist will report to the H&B Suppor t Supervisor in the ACES (Accountholder and Client Experience Support) Organization . This role is responsible for supporting our customers' journey through the healthcare reimbursement system. This position is challenging, fast paced, and rewarding while delivering one superior quality experience at a time.
  • You will be accountable for helping accountholders understand how their healthcare reimbursement accounts work. When someone calls in with questions, you will provide friendly and helpful service, making sure the caller feels supported. You will be explain ing how the benefits and policies work, so accountholders know how to get the most out of their individual plans.
  • You will be responsible for ensuring all work is compliant with all internal quality assurance standards and technical policies and programs.
  • You will be committed to providing the highest level of service to each caller, treating them with empathy, understanding, and respect .
  • Consult with accountholders to support easy navigation of the available online tools and apps , f or actions like checking an account balance and submitting claims.
  • Accountable for resolving issues without management intervention to remove barriers for the member .
  • You will receive additional call type skills after initial training and may be cross trained to other channels (like chat, email or text) on a later date according to business need.
  • Accountable to protect sensitive member information with discretion and adhere to all compliance rules and regulations.
  • Responsible for all levels of member engagement, while prioritizing effectively to meet member service goals / deadlines.
  • Other duties as assigned.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
